1. Getting Started with Betfair Betting
Betfair is the world’s biggest betting exchange, which means you’re not just placing a bet against a bookie – you’re matching your wager with other punters. For Aussie players the platform feels familiar because the UI mirrors the classic sportsbook layout, yet the liquidity can be noticeably deeper on popular events like the AFL and cricket.
Before you dive in, make sure you have a stable internet connection and a valid Australian bank account. Most newcomers start with a modest deposit, test the exchange on a low‑stakes horse race, and then gradually explore the richer markets like live betting on the NRL. The learning curve isn’t steep, but a bit of patience goes a long way.
2. Registration & Verification – What You Need to Know
The sign‑up process on Betfair is straightforward: you’ll be asked for your name, address, date of birth, and a contact phone number. Australian law requires identity verification (KYC) before you can withdraw funds, so keep a scan of your driver’s licence or passport handy.
During verification the system may request a utility bill to confirm your residential address. This step usually takes 24‑48 hours, but if you upload clear images the turnaround can be near‑instant. Remember, a fully verified account unlocks higher betting limits and faster withdrawal speeds.

4. Understanding Betfair’s Bonus Landscape
Betfair doesn’t have the flashy casino “no‑deposit” offers you see elsewhere; its focus is the exchange model. However, the platform does run occasional “betting credit” promotions for new Australian users, typically matching a percentage of your first deposit up to a set amount.
Key things to watch:
- Wagering requirements: Usually expressed as “X times the bonus amount”. Make sure you understand how many bets you must place before you can cash out.
- Expiry dates: Bonus credits often expire within 30 days, so plan your betting schedule accordingly.
- Eligible markets: Some promotions only apply to sports like AFL, cricket, or horse racing, not to the casino‑style games.
Because the bonus is credited as betting credit, you can’t withdraw it directly. It must be turned into real money by meeting the stipulated wagering requirements.
